What Is Arthroscopic Knee Surgery
Arthroscopic knee surgery is a minimally invasive alternative to traditional knee replacement. It uses a series of small incisions that allow a tiny camera, called an arthroscope, to be inserted into the knee region to better visualize the damaged joint that needs to be replaced. The use of an arthroscope allows for greater precision while minimizing the impact on the surrounding muscles and tissues.
The camera on the arthroscope will transmit real-time images of your knee joint onto a screen, making it possible for your knee surgeon to replace the damaged portions of your knee joint with greater accuracy and improving the surgical outcome.
Differences Between Arthroscopic Knee Surgery and Traditional Knee Replacement
There are several key differences between arthroscopic and traditional knee replacement procedures. These include:
Incision Size – Arthroscopic knee replacement uses smaller incisions than traditional knee replacement surgery.
Tissue Impact – The smaller incisions in arthroscopic knee replacement cause less trauma to surrounding muscles, tissues, tendons and ligaments. In contrast, the larger incisions used in traditional knee replacement result in more extensive disruption to the surrounding tissue.
Surgical Precision – The use of an arthroscope provides magnified visualization of the knee joint throughout the procedure, allowing for greater levels of precision.
Applicability – While the arthroscopic technique is ideally suited for most knee replacement procedures, it may not be the best option in very complex cases involving extensive damage. In these cases, traditional surgery may provide better access to the damaged knee joint.
Benefits of Arthroscopic Knee Surgery
Due to the minimally invasive nature of arthroscopic knee surgery, it offers several important benefits compared with traditional knee replacement:
Faster Recovery Time – Since smaller incisions are used and less surrounding tissue is disrupted, patients who undergo arthroscopic knee surgery will typically heal more quickly. This allows you to start your postsurgical physical therapy sooner, resulting in a faster overall recovery time. In most instances, you may be able to resume normal activities faster with arthroscopic knee replacement.
Reduced Pain and Swelling – The minimally invasive nature of arthroscopic knee surgery results in less pain and swelling than occurs after traditional knee replacement.
Reduced Risk of Complications – While there are risks associated with any surgical procedure, arthroscopic knee surgery typically results in fewer complications than traditional knee replacement. Smaller incisions reduce the risk of infection, and there’s a lower risk of blood clots compared with more invasive procedures.
Improved Long-Term Outcomes – Arthroscopic knee replacement often produces better long-term outcomes that allow you to maintain improved joint function and mobility for many years following your surgery.
Less Scarring – The smaller incisions used in arthroscopic knee surgery result in less scarring, which may be an important consideration for many patients.
